Ingredients

For the Dip
- 32 ounces Velveeta cheese
- 2 (15-oz) cans no bean chili
- 2 cups whole milk
- 6 tablespoons lime juice (juice from 3 limes)
- 3 tablespoons chili powder
- 2 tablespoons paprika
- 2 tablespoons cumin
- 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
For Serving
- Tortilla chips
- Chopped onions (to garnish, optional)
- Chopped cilantro (to garnish, optional)
- Lime wedges (to garnish, optional)
How to Make Copycat Chili’s Queso Dip (Slow Cooker)
Step 1: Prepare Your Slow Cooker
Begin by plugging in your slow cooker and setting it to low heat. This allows the cheese to melt slowly for optimal creaminess.
Step 2: Combine Ingredients
In the slow cooker:
1. Cut the Velveeta cheese into small cubes for easier melting.
2. Add the cubes along with the no bean chili, whole milk, lime juice, chili powder, paprika, cumin, and cayenne pepper.
3. Stir everything together until well combined.
Step 3: Cook Until Smooth
Cover your slow cooker and let it cook for about 60 minutes. Stir occasionally during cooking to ensure all ingredients meld together into a creamy dip.
Step 4: Serve with Toppings
Once done, transfer your queso dip to a serving bowl. Serve warm with tortilla chips on the side. Add optional garnishes like chopped onions, cilantro, or lime wedges for an extra zing!

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Making Copycat Chili’s Queso Dip (Slow Cooker) can be a breeze, but some common pitfalls can ruin your experience. Here are mistakes to watch out for:
-
Overheating the Cheese: Melting cheese too quickly can lead to a gritty texture. Always melt it slowly in the slow cooker or on low heat.
-
Ignoring Measurements: Not measuring ingredients accurately can throw off the flavor balance. Use precise measurements, especially for spices and liquids.
-
Skipping Garnishes: Garnishes like chopped onions or cilantro enhance flavor and presentation. Don’t skip them; they make your dip more appealing!
-
Using Low-Quality Ingredients: Cheap cheese or canned chili can affect taste. Invest in good-quality Velveeta and chili for the best results.
-
Not Stirring Enough: Failing to stir occasionally may cause uneven melting. Stir your queso dip every 15 minutes to keep it creamy.

Storage & Reheating Instructions
Refrigerator Storage
- Store leftover queso dip in an airtight container.
- It will last for about 3–4 days in the refrigerator.
Freezing Copycat Chili’s Queso Dip (Slow Cooker)
- Freeze in an airtight container or freezer bag.
- It can be stored for up to 2 months.
Reheating Copycat Chili’s Queso Dip (Slow Cooker)
-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C) and reheat covered for about 20 minutes, stirring halfway through.
- Microwave: Heat in a microwave-safe bowl in short intervals, stirring frequently until warm.
- Stovetop: Heat gently over low heat, stirring continuously to avoid burning.
